Description : ICRC website article, 10.05.2016: “In Nigeria, fear, anxiety and a long journey home. Fear and anxiety. They are emotions that a teenager, a blind man and two brothers in Nigeria had in common after outbreaks of violence forced them to flee so quickly they lost track of their family. The four share something else in common: A happy ending. [...] Violence forced two brothers – Mohammed, 17, and Sadiq, 15 – to flee twice. Their family was first pushed out of their home town of Gwoza. They resettled in Mubi, but the swift onset of violence there forced a fast flight. Having lost contact with their family, the brothers traveled first to Yola and then to Maiduguri. That's where they met with ICRC field officers.
"I gave them a relative´s phone number from memory," Mohammed said. The ICRC team tracked down the teens' father through that relative. "I cannot wait to see my family," Sadiq said on the day they left the camp to return home. The father of Mohammed and Sadiq welcomed the return of his two sons. Though they are still living as displaced persons in Mubi, the family hopes to safely return to Gwoza soon. [...]"
